The chromatic tuner shows the nearest pitch name (semitone) and how far the input sound is from that pitch.

Delay effects and some modulation and filter effects can be synchronized to the tempo. Select an effect that can be synchronized, and set its Time, Rate or other parameter that can be synchronized to a or note value. The tempo can be set by tapping the footswitch or a knob.
